Governor Vetoes Bill on Contraception Qualms

Gov. Janet Napolitano vetoed a bill that would have allowed pharmacists to refuse to provide emergency contraception if doing so conflicted with their moral or religious beliefs.

Napolitano, who supports abortion rights, said in her veto letter to lawmakers that pharmacies and other healthcare providers “have no right to interfere with the lawful personal medical decisions made by patients and their doctors.”
